COVID-19 Immunity and Changes Over Time

Condition: COVID-19  ·  Sponsor: Chinese University of Hong Kong

PhaseN/A
Planned participants1350
Who can joinAll sexes, N/A to no upper limit
Healthy volunteersNo

About this study

The risk of household spread of SARS-CoV-2 hinges on both the transmission dynamics of the virus circulating in the community as well as the seroprotection pattern of constituent members, which can be attributed to vaccination and previous infections. This study is conceptualised to assess the dynamicity of SARS-CoV-2 risk at the household level, through monitoring the pattern of seroprotection, in conjunction with the vaccination coverage, history of infection and exposure risk in the setting of Hong Kong.
